EPA | HEPA | ULPA filters
Plastic frame | Construction depths 150 + 292 mm | EPA
Specifications
Filter medium Micro-glass-fiber paper, highly resistant to moisture and oils
Bursting pressure > 3,000 Pa
Thermal stability 70 °C
Moisture resistance 100 % rel. hum.
Frame Halogen-free plastic; on request also with frame made from galvanized steel or stainless steel sheeting
Seal Semicircular PU profile, endlessly foamed, on one side; on request with flat seal
Protection grids Plastic, on both sides (N18N), with 200 mm pleat depth standard version without protection grid (N 10N)
